On the night of April 4, Russian occupation forces struck a residential area in the center of Sumy, resulting in a fire in a high-rise building, 11 victims, including  a child  .

Source : Head of Sumy OVA Oleg Hrygorov , Acting Mayor of Sumy Artem Kobzar , " Suspilne Sumy ", State Emergency Service , National Police

Grigorov's direct speech : "Previously, the Russians struck the regional center with strike UAVs. A fire broke out on the upper floors of a high-rise building in the Zarechny district."

Details : The singer noted that three explosions were heard in the city.

Kobzar's direct speech : "A UAV was recorded hitting an apartment building in the Zarichny district, resulting in a fire.

Another hit was also recorded in a yard in the same area."

According to the head of the Sumy MVA, Serhiy Kryvosheyenko, the shooting occurred on the 13th floor of a 16-story building in the center of Sumy.

Update : Grigorov later reported three casualties from the Russian strike. He also noted that people were being evacuated from damaged buildings and posted a video of a high-rise building engulfed in fire.

According to Kryvosheyenko, four people were injured.

Updated : This morning, the State Emergency Service reported that in Sumy, UAV strike aircraft hit a 16-story building and a private residential area.

According to preliminary data from rescuers, the number of victims as a result of the impact reached 7, including a child.

Updated : After 7 a.m., police reported that the number of victims in the overnight strike on Sumy has increased to 11, including  a 15-year-old child.
